Web1.1 This specification covers an adhesive for bonding prefabricated acoustical materials to the inside walls and ceilings of rooms in buildings. This adhesive is required to maintain a tensile adhesion (bond strength) of not less than 3.45 × 10 4 dynes/cm 2 (1 / 2 lb/in. 2) for a long period of time under the temperature and moisture conditions likely to be …

WebBooths & Enclosures. Acoustical Solutions offers a range of sound booths and enclosures that can be used to encapsulate or direct the path of sound and noise. Audiometric booths are prefabricated booths utilized for audiology testing or as a sound isolation booth. Blanket enclosures are custom configured to surround and block sound from equipment. WebThicker pressed felt material, although light, is often fabricated to be more rigid, shape-retaining, and is more difficult to cut. Multi-dimensional acoustic felt webs, baffles, and grids offer a greater sound control option too, with NRC values reaching 1.20.
